Land for sale in Helensvale, Harare North, is priced at the higher end, with the average price of properties currently listed at $167,650. Land sizes vary widely, from smaller plots of about 600 ㎡ to large parcels reaching up to 56,656 ㎡, with the median land area around 4,974 ㎡. These plots offer a range of options for buyers looking for spacious residential land in a well-established suburb.
Many of the land parcels benefit from tarred roads, making access convenient and improving the overall appeal. The properties are primarily suited for residential development, with no buildings currently included, allowing buyers to plan and build according to their preferences. The area’s quiet, family-friendly atmosphere makes it ideal for those seeking a peaceful living environment.
Helensvale is known for its tree-lined streets and suburban feel, blending middle-income and upper-middle-income households. Residents enjoy proximity to the Harare Botanical Gardens and Lake Chivero Recreational Park for outdoor activities. The suburb also offers good access to schools, healthcare facilities like Parirenyatwa Group of Hospitals, and shopping centers including Sam Levy’s Village. Well-connected by major roads and public transport, Helensvale provides a balanced lifestyle with easy access to central Harare and surrounding northern suburbs.
